The method
The six steps of a Gonstead assessment
Gonstead is a process of elimination. Each step narrows the search until only the segment actually causing your pain is left. We then adjust that one joint rather than the whole spine.

History Taking
Your chiropractor will ask you questions regarding the location and issue of your problem and what activities that typically relieve or aggravate it. These important information help to evaluate your condition and overall health.
Visualisation
By observing your spine, a lot of information can be obtained. The curves of the spine, the level of your head, ears, shoulders, hips and knees; give a visual indication of your spinal health. Often by the way you walk, or move your body give clues as to the location of subluxation.
Instrumentation
A "nervoscope" is an instrument that we use; for the measurement of skin temperature on either side of the spine. The blood flow to the skin is regulated by spinal nerves. An alteration in spinal function will cause a change in nerve function, affecting blood flow to the skin and changing the temperature. This is an important piece of puzzle in the determination of the root cause.
Palpation
Palpation is a method where your chiropractor feels your spine and the surrounding tissues for problems with her fingers. Your chiropractor feels for the presence of swelling, tenderness and tight muscle fibres around. In addition, a full-motion assessment will also be conducted to evaluate each spinal and pelvic joints. A great deal of information can be obtained from every motion of the body.
X-Ray Analysis
The X-Ray imaging is a valuable tool, both in helping to determine where the problem is located and in deciding how it is best approached. X-Rays are used to rule out pathologies, assess intervertebral discs and spinal joints. If your chiropractor feels another healthcare provider would better help you, you will be referred appropriately.
Adjustments
After your comprehensive assessment, your Gonstead Chiropractor will consider all the information gathered to build a clear picture of what is driving your problem, and decide which adjustment is most appropriate. The adjustments will be delivered precisely and skilfully by hands only.

Is chiropractic care safe?
Chiropractic adjustment is widely used for mechanical spine and joint problems, and serious complications are considered rare when care follows a proper assessment. As with any hands-on care there can be short lived after effects, most often mild soreness or stiffness for a day or so. The assessment exists partly to screen for the small number of situations where adjustment would not be appropriate, which is why we work through it before deciding what, if anything, to adjust. We will always tell you honestly if we think chiropractic is not the right approach for your case.
Does a chiropractic adjustment hurt?
Most people describe an adjustment as brief pressure followed by a release rather than as pain. The popping sound that often comes with it is gas moving within the joint, not bone grinding on bone, and it is not a measure of whether the adjustment worked. Some soreness for a day afterwards is common, particularly on a first visit or where an area has been guarded for a long time. Tell your chiropractor if anything feels worse than uncomfortable, because the contact and the force can both be adjusted, and there are lower force approaches we use for patients who would rather not be adjusted in the usual way.

What is the Gonstead method?
Gonstead is a chiropractic technique built around a detailed six-step assessment before any adjustment is made. That includes instrumentation and, where indicated, X-ray analysis. The aim is to identify precisely which segment is involved rather than working on the region generally.
Do I need an X-ray before chiropractic care?
An X-ray gives us a clearer picture of what is happening in your spine: how each segment sits, and whether there is any pathology present. That is what lets the Gonstead assessment name the specific segment involved instead of working in general terms. It is not mandatory, though, and we often go without one for pregnant women and children. Your chiropractor will explain whether imaging is appropriate in your case and why.
Is chiropractic the same as bone setting or tit tar?
No. Chiropractic is a regulated healthcare profession with formal university training, and assessment comes before anything is adjusted. Traditional bone setting works differently and is not regulated in the same way. We would encourage you to ask any practitioner about their qualifications beforehand.
Can I see a chiropractor while pregnant?
Yes, pregnancy is one of the more common reasons people come to us, and we adjust through it regularly. We avoid imaging during pregnancy unless there is a compelling reason, and the assessment and the positioning both change as the pregnancy progresses. Tell your chiropractor how far along you are at the first visit so the approach can be set accordingly.
Do you see children and teenagers?
Yes, the clinic cares for patients of all ages, and children are assessed differently from adults rather than being given a smaller version of adult care. We generally go without an X-ray for children. A parent or guardian stays in the room throughout, and we will explain what we are looking at as we go.
